A striking original color lithograph from a limited edition of 100 copies. Printed on heavy Arches wove paper, depicting a dramatic, primal mask composition in fiery red, intense yellow, and deep black fields. Hand-signed in white pencil lower right and numbered 11/100 lower left.

In Death of a Viking, Bengt Lindström channels the monumental intensity of Norse legend, presenting a raw, grimacing warrior form emerging from deep black background. The aggressive black linework and saturated red-and-yellow color scheme embody the raw emotion and neo-primitive vigor central to the CoBrA Movement ethos.
